Biological Manipulation
From The Codex

Background
Biological Manipulation is the ability to manipulate organic beings and matter on a biological level. This encompasses control over cellular structures, genetic material, bodily functions, and entire organisms. Users of this power can influence the form, function, and health of living beings, from subtle enhancements to complete restructuring. It may also confer immunity to disease, enable rapid healing, or allow for mutation and evolution.
Biological Manipulation is often associated with high adaptability, and depending on the user's finesse, can be used for both medical and combative purposes. It can manifest through direct contact, remote control, or even microscopic influence over biological systems.

Possible Applications
- Body Control: Directly controlling or influencing the bodies of others.
- Shapeshifting: Morphing one’s body or others by altering muscle, bone, or genetic layout.
- Genetic Alteration: Rewriting DNA sequences to induce changes such as increased strength, resistance, or new traits.
- Cellular Control: Accelerating or halting cell growth, useful in healing or causing deterioration.
- Disease Manipulation: Creating, nullifying, or controlling bacteria, viruses, or plagues.
- Adaptation: Granting oneself or others rapid adaptation to environments, toxins, or injuries.
- Regeneration: Healing wounds by rapidly repairing damaged tissue or limbs.
- Biological Fusion: Combining two or more organisms into a single new form.
- Mind-Body Manipulation: Altering hormonal levels or nervous system responses to influence behavior or perception.
- Creating Organic Constructs: Generating living organisms or biomass-based structures.
- Poison/Antidote Creation: Manipulating bodily chemistry to generate poisons or their cures.

Variations
- Microscopic Biological Manipulation: Focused on internal, cellular, or molecular processes.
- Macroscopic Biological Manipulation: Affecting full organisms or large-scale organic matter.
- External vs Internal Manipulation: Some users manipulate their own biology, while others can externally affect others.
Possible Limitations
- Complexity: Precise manipulation of biology often requires deep understanding of anatomy or genetics.
- Energy Drain: Drastic changes to living tissue can be taxing, potentially exhausting the user.
- Moral/Instinctual Interference: Changing living beings may have ethical implications or trigger unexpected survival responses.
- Time Constraints: Some changes, especially those at the genetic level, may take time to manifest.
